Is NASDAQ NFLX Still the King of Streaming Stocks?
When it comes to streaming services, NASDAQ NFLX has long held the crown. But with the rise of powerful competitors like Disney+ and HBO Max, is Netflix’s dominance still as strong as ever? Let’s dive into the factors that are shaping the future of Netflix and its stock on the NASDAQ.
One of the key drivers of NASDAQ NFLX is its global expansion strategy. Netflix continues to grow its international subscriber base, targeting regions where it still sees huge potential. This international growth is crucial as the U.S. market becomes more saturated. When Netflix announces strong growth in these regions, it often results in a positive movement for the stock.
Another factor is Netflix’s unparalleled investment in original content. Shows like Stranger Things, The Witcher, and Money Heist have been massive hits, helping the company differentiate itself from other streaming platforms. However, the cost of creating such high-quality content is immense. Any delays or underperforming releases can pose significant risks to the stock’s performance.
Lastly, Netflix has been introducing new business models like ad-supported subscriptions. Some investors view this as a smart way to reach budget-conscious viewers, but others are cautious about how it will impact the brand's premium appeal.
As NASDAQ NFLX continues to innovate and adapt to a rapidly changing market, it remains a stock worth watching closely. The streaming wars are far from over, and Netflix’s next moves could be game-changers in the industry.
